GCCC moves step closer to venue redevelopment

Gloucestershire Country Cricket Club (GCCC) has moved one step closer to developing its stadium, including improving conferencing and hospitality facilities.

The Bristol club wants to become one of the chosen venues for international cricket matches by increasing the seating capacity by 4,000, creating a world-class media centre and upgrading the gym facilities.

Planning officers at Bristol City Council have decided to recommend approval of the two applications submitted by the club to redevelop its existing stadium.

Councillors will make a final decision on the plans at a meeting on March 10th.

"It is difficult to stress the importance of the proposed developments to our long term future in Bristol, not only for the county team and the club as a whole but also for our surrounding community," said Rex Body, chairman of GCCC.

Lancashire County Cricket Club is also currently undergoing redevelopment of its Old Trafford ground, including improving conference and banqueting facilities.
